✦ Synopsis
The performance of lithium copper oxyphosphate, a 2.4 V operating voltage battery system using 2 M LiC104/dioxolane, is presented. The cells have excellent discharge characteristics and shelf life, and also demonstrate some advantage in capacity over Li/MnO* cells of the same size at the 2 V cut-off voltage.
